  • GKN sees its profits halve

    February 25, 2010

    Automotive and aerospace engineer GKN said full-year trading profit halved but the outlook for its major markets is mainly positive. Trading profit fell to £152m for the year ended 31 December 2009 from £221m the year before. Sales for the period were down three per cent at £4.2bn.

  • Profits plunge at Bodycote

    February 25, 2010

    Engineering firm Bodycote reported a decline in full-year pre-tax profit warning that it expects a full recovery from the slump to take several years. Headline pre-tax profit fell to £3.7m for the year ended 31 December from £67.6m a year before. Revenue declined to £435.4m from £551.8m the year before.
